This breathtaking, modern home is close to Downtown Belfast which is brimming with fabulous independent stores that each have their own distinct charm. There are bars & restaurants aplenty, most with a local-food movement vibe, farmers markets, art galleries, a legendary movie theater & more. Take the Harbor walk or Rail trail right along the water and through town or jump on a quick harbor tour on a local lobster boat to a famous Lobster Pound, all just minutes from your doorstep. We have plenty of parking at the property and Belfast center is a 4 minute drive or 20 minute walk. We are 10 minutes walk away from Young's lobster pound & the large supermarket 'Hannaford' is 4 minutes drive away. We recommend having a car as there is so much to see. Acadia national park and Bar Harbor are 1.5 hours drive away. To get here you can fly into Rockland, Augusta or Bangor which are all 1 hour drive away. Portland is 2 hours drive and Boston 3.5.
